North Carolina Secretary of State's Securities Division
Chooses Legal Files

 

Oct. 26, 2011

Legal Files Software, Inc., a leading developer of case and matter management software, today announced that the North Carolina Department of the Secretary of State’s Securities Division has purchased its popular web/browser version of its case management software. The Securities Division regulates all aspects of the securities industry at the state level.

Legal Files Software, Inc. was awarded the contract based on various factors, including the software’s user-friendly interface and its interface with GroupWise, an email messaging system from Novell. The state agency wanted a case management solution to meet the needs of its 45 users, which consist of attorneys, paralegals, support staff and investigators. A key factor in the selection was Legal Files’ ability to enhance the agency’s current software investment. Legal Files e-mail integration with GroupWise gives the agency the ability to save sent and received e-mail to a case or matter stored in Legal Files, creating one, central location for all case and matter related information. In addition, Legal Files offers two-way synchronization for GroupWise appointments, tasks and contacts.

“We were pleased to find a case management solution that integrates with our environment,” said Zesely Haislip, Jr., a Senior Enforcement Attorney and the Director of the ARS Project Group at the North Carolina Secretary of State’s Securities Division.

“We’ve had many years of experience working with public sector customers,” said John Kanoski, CEO at Legal Files Software Inc. “Over the years, we have learned what issues are the most important factors in efficiently operating a government legal department. We look forward to providing this knowledge and expertise to the Securities Division.”
